What is the primary purpose of implant-displaced views (Eklund views)?

Explanation:
Implant-displaced views are about removing the implant from the line of sight so the breast tissue behind it can be seen clearly. By displacing the implant away from the chest wall and imaging the tissue that sits behind it, radiologists can detect lesions that would otherwise be hidden by the implant’s shielding. This is the core purpose: to visualize the underlying breast tissue for any abnormalities. These views aren’t designed to check implant integrity—that requires other tests like MRI or ultrasound or dedicated implant evaluation methods. They also don’t reduce radiation exposure; in fact, they add more views and can increase the dose. They aren’t specifically for imaging axillary lymph nodes, either. The primary goal is to reveal tissue behind the implant to spot underlying lesions.
